Florida Learner's License : Requirements & Steps to Get It
Earning a learner's permit in Florida is the initial step toward becoming a fully qualified driver . To qualify for this permit , applicants must be at least 15 years of age. Younger applicants, being 14 , may be granted a restricted permit with parental permission. You’ll need to pass a written knowledge test on traffic laws and signs, and successfully complete a vision check. Besides, you'll be required to attend a recognized driver's education program, which can be either classroom-based or a combination of online and classroom instruction . Afterward, you’ll need to apply to the FL Department of Highway Safety and Motor Vehicles (DHSMV), providing documentation of address, identity , and SS number. Once accepted, you’ll receive your provisional license, allowing you to operate a car with a experienced driver present you.
- Minimum of 15 years.
- Succeed in the written test .
- Complete traffic education.
- Provide proof of residency .

New to Driving? Your Florida Permit Checklist
Getting behind the wheel in Florida starts with securing your learner’s license . It might seem tricky at first, but this checklist will guide you! First, you'll need to pass a vision exam and a knowledge exam on Florida traffic rules . Study the Florida Driver’s Handbook – it's your primary resource! Next, you will need to submit proof of address and social security number . After you pass your permit, you’ll be required to practice supervised driving learner license florida time before you can take your road test. Here's a quick rundown:
- Complete a vision screening
- Achieve the knowledge exam
- Provide proof of living situation
- Obtain parental permission (if under 18)
- Record your supervised driving hours
